Mission
Proactively provide cost effective, reliable, standardized, and current information technology tools, systems, and services including customer focused support.
The Network and Operations Division
designs, maintains, and monitors the City’s data and telephone networks. The division also orders, delivers, repairs, and maintains all desktop and handheld personal computers, and staffs and manages the computer Help Desk. It also assures the integrity and security of data operations, and oversees and manages the City’s data center. This division supports over 350 computers spread across 11 locations. They respond to around 300 Help Desk calls per month and support 34 servers.
The Applications Division
procures, maintains, and supports primary computer applications such as financial, payroll, utilities, permitting, public safety, and parks and recreation systems and related database systems. They work closely with many vendors to assure good vendor/client relationships and manage software support contracts with vendors. This group also manages the Internet web site and our Intranet.
The Geographic Information Systems division
designs, implements, manages, and maintains enterprise-wide mapping and spatial data analysis tools, mapping applications, and vendor relationships. GIS staff also coordinates closely with departmental GIS staff and provides direct support to departments that do not have experienced GIS professional staff.
The Multimedia Services Division
supports city staff with graphic design and production, primarily for print media such as posters, brochures, fliers, calendars, invitations, banners, etc. Multimedia Services also creates most of the non-video television content and occasionally helps with special-purpose web design and development..
